The following publication doesn't have the lat longs, but has the rest, so here it is. Page 13.

Some abbreviations you will see.

TSR (terminal surveillance radar) is PSR + SSR
ISSR is Independent SSR, meaning a stand alone SSR radar, mostly used in remote locations for enroute radar coverage.
WAM is Wide area multilateration.
ADS-B is, well, ADS-B. (satellites and all !)
